What is the difference between Chief Representative Officer vs Business Development Manager?
| Aspect | Chief Representative Officer | Business Development Manager |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Typically requires advanced degrees and extensive industry experience | Usually holds a bachelor's degree, with experience in sales or marketing |
| Work Environment | Strategic leadership in regional or international offices | Operational role focused on client acquisition and market expansion |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Common in multinational corporations, especially in Asia and emerging markets | Widely used across industries for growth initiatives |
The Chief Representative Officer primarily oversees regional operations and strategic representation, while the Business Development Manager focuses on expanding business opportunities and client relationships. Both roles are vital but differ in scope and responsibilities within the industry.

Job description
- Assists the CEO, Officers and Key staff in developing and implementing the health center’s mission and strategic plan.
- Demonstrates, through behavior, CareSTL Health’s care values of customer services, community, comprehensive, commitment and competence.
- (1)Participates as a key member of organization’s Executive Leadership Team (ELT) to develop and maintain a strategic plan for the controlled growth, expansion, and/or development of programs and sites for CareSTL Health; solve existing and anticipated financial organizational problems; and formulate and/or revise policies that will enhance the achievement of the organization’s goals. Attends all ELT meetings with the overriding and ongoing goal of integrating financial aspects of care within CareSTL Health finances and services.
- (2)Oversees Risk Management and directs the Quality Assurance and Improvement (QA amp;I) process for the Finance Department within CareSTL Health. The CFO is responsible for removing financial barriers to achieving quality in medical care and for reporting to internal and external committees and entities, as required.
- (3)Oversee the management and coordination of all fiscal reporting activities for the organization including reporting and managing the cash flow process to meet the organization's needs, managing organizational revenue/expense and balance sheet reports, reporting to funding agencies, and developing and monitoring all organizational contract and grant budgets.
- (4)Provide the Executive Leadership Team with an operating budget. Work with the Executive Leadership Team to ensure organizational success through cost analysis support, and compliance with all contractual and health center program requirements. This includes: 1) interpreting legislative and health care rules and regulations to ensure compliance with all federal, state, local and contractual guidelines, 2) ensuring that all government regulations and requirements are disseminated to appropriate personnel, and 3) monitoring compliance.
- (5)Develop and maintain systems of internal controls to safeguard financial assets of the organization and oversee federal awards and programs. Oversee the coordination and activities of independent auditors ensuring all A-133 audit issues are resolved, and all 403(b) compliance issues are met, and the preparation of the annual financial statements is in accordance with U.S. GAAP and federal, state and other required supplementary schedules and information.
- Attend Board and Subcommittee meetings; including being the lead staff on the Audit/Finance Committee.
- Monitor banking activities of the organization.
- Oversee all accounting, registration and billing activity for staff and participants.
- Oversee the production of monthly reports including reconciliations with funders and pension plan requirements, as well as financial statements and cash flow projections for use by Executive Leadership Team, as well as the Audit/Finance Committee and Board of Directors.
- Assess the benefits of all prospective contracts and advise the Executive Leadership Team on programmatic design and implementation matters.
- Ensure adequate controls are installed and that substantiating documentation is approved and available such that all purchases may pass independent and governmental audits.
- Serve as one of the trustees and oversee administration and financial reporting of the organization's Retirement Plan.
- Investigate cost-effective benefit plans and other fringe benefits which the organization may offer employees and potential employees with the goal of attracting and retaining qualified individuals.
- Assist in the design, implementation, and timely calculations of wage incentives, bonuses, and salaries for the staff.
- Oversee Accounting and Revenue departments and ensure a disaster recovery plan is in place.
- Oversee business insurance plans and health care coverage analysis.
- Oversee the maintenance of the inventory of all fixed assets, including assets purchased with government funds (computers, etc.) assuring all are in accordance with federal regulations.
